Raw Material Picking Work for All Qty + Restrict RAF if Raw Material Picking Work is Open

Hi,

I am using Raw material picking WMS menu item for production order to pick the inventory from storage location and to put in input location of the resource assigned to the route operation. Production parameter is set to reserve the quantity on "Release". I have 2 following questions on this:

1: When I click release on production order, system is looking at resource input location to reserve the quantity. If quantity is not available on input location then system is generating Raw Material Picking work to pick the quantity from storage location. If the production order is for 10 qty then system should also generate Raw material picking work for 10 quantity however system is only generating work for quantity available in storage location. E.g. Production order is for 10 qty and no quantity is available on input location and only 6 quantity is available on storage location then system is generating raw material picking work for 6 qty. I want system to generate raw material picking work for full qty of 10. 

2: Currently, system allow to start the production order and I can also complete RAF process using mobile application despite the fact that raw material picking work is still open. System should restrict to start production order if Raw Material Picking work is open.

    Hi Zeehan, Warehouse work can only be created for what can be physical reserved. If there is on 6 pieces in inventory, then work can only be created for that quantity even though the requested quantity is 10. With regards to your suggestion of restricting production start to when all work is closed, this is not in the plans as some customers are releasing work continuously after the production or batch order is started.

    Hi,

    1. What do you mean by generating work for 10 if only 6 is available? Wheres the other 4 you expect a work from if it's not in stock? You can set the parameter requirement for material reservation to "require full reservation" on either the bom line or production control parameters. If you do this, D365 expect the full quantity to be reserved otherwise no work is generated at all.
     
    2. How are you consuming your bom lines? If you for example configure the system to backflush when reporting as finish this will make a check that all the materials are available at the input location of the operations resource during report as finish. 
    Otherwise you can prevent the order from getting released if you use "require full reservation" and also using the feature "Prevent production orders to be released when full material is not available". 

    Best regards, Elias
